Core Functionality
The primary purpose of the Lambda Sensor LS5261 is to measure the oxygen concentration in exhaust gases. By providing real‑time data to the Engine Control Unit (ECU), it enables precise adjustment of the air–fuel mixture, ensuring:
- Optimal Combustion Efficiency: Adjusts fuel delivery for maximum power output.
- Reduced Fuel Consumption: Maintains lean mixtures where appropriate.
- Lower Emissions: Keeps exhaust gases within regulatory limits.
- Enhanced Engine Longevity: Prevents excessive wear caused by improper combustion.

Technical Specifications Summary
| Parameter | Description |
|---|---|
| Model Number | 0258005261 (LS5261) |
| Connector Type | Four‑pole vehicle‑specific plug |
| Length | 450 mm |
| Operating Temperature | –40 °C to 600 °C |
| Response Time | <50 ms |
| Signal Output | Voltage (0.1 V – 0.9 V) |
| Compatibility | Nissan Micra II (K11) and similar models |
| Material | High‑temperature alloy housing, ceramic sensor element |
